Wicked: For Good follows Elphaba, the future Wicked Witch of the West and her relationship with Glinda, the Good Witch of the North. The second of a two-part feature film adaptation of the Broadway musical.
Cast: Ariana Grande, Cynthia Erivo, Jonathan Bailey, Ethan Slater, Michelle Yeoh, Jeff Goldblum, Marissa Bode, Ryan Mann, Adam James, Michael Guarnera
Director(s): Jon M. Chu

The magical world of Oz returns in Wicked: For Good, the epic conclusion to the two-part adaptation of the beloved Broadway musical. Directed by Jon M. Chu (Crazy Rich Asians, In the Heights), this much-anticipated sequel continues the story of Elphaba and Glinda, two powerful women whose friendship, choices, and destinies shaped the land of Oz forever.

Set in the aftermath of Wicked: Part One, Elphaba (played by Cynthia Erivo) has disappeared, branded the "Wicked Witch of the West" and presumed dead after her dramatic escape. Glinda (played by Ariana Grande) is left to pick up the pieces, grappling with her public role as Oz’s shining star while privately mourning her closest friend.

But as the cracks in the Wizard’s regime deepen, and the people of Oz begin to question the truth they've been told, Glinda must confront her own beliefs and decide whether to stand up for what’s right even if it costs her everything. Meanwhile, Elphaba is forced to go underground, joining resistance forces in the shadows and preparing for a final confrontation that could change Oz forever.

Featuring a dazzling supporting cast including Jonathan Bailey as Fiyero, Michelle Yeoh as Madame Morrible, and Jeff Goldblum as the Wizard, Wicked: For Good brings both spectacle and soul to the screen. Expect show-stopping musical numbers like “No Good Deed” and “As Long As You’re Mine,” along with new original songs from legendary composer Stephen Schwartz, one of which reportedly brought the cast and crew to tears on set.

With breathtaking visuals, powerful performances, and a moving story about identity, justice, and sacrifice, Wicked: For Good is the cinematic event of 2025. Whether you’re a lifelong fan or discovering Oz for the first time, this is a story that will stay with you long after the credits roll.

Did you know?

“For Good,” the iconic final duet between Glinda and Elphaba, inspired the title of the film. Composer Stephen Schwartz collaborated with Jon M. Chu to write brand-new music exclusively for this final chapter.
